You will be working alongside the system/office People teams as well as L&D, Finance and other adjacent BCG functions.ADDITIONAL INFORMATIONClimate & Sustainability (C&S) is a fast-growing Practice Area and a driving force for BCG's ambition to become the most positively impactful company in the world.As part of our commitment to protecting the planet and helping clients achieve sustainable competitive advantage, BCG is deepening and broadening its focus. C&S brings together 500+ experts covering the full range of climate and sustainability topics, including biodiversity, circular economy, decarbonization, sustainable agriculture, transition financing, water management, and other ESG topics—across all sectors—to support our clients around the world.C&S is unique in that it operates a virtual system in each of the three regions (APAC, EMESA and NAMR) with a distinct P&L and staff who are (co)hosted by the system but who are physically located in BCG offices around the world.The C&S market is developing at an unprecedented pace across industries and around the world and will continue to grow rapidly in the coming years.
